MSNBC hires Eugene Daniels as Joy Reid's replacement
MSNBC has announced the hiring of Eugene Daniels as their new Senior Washington Correspondent and co-host of 'The Weekend,' following the firing of Joy Reid and the cancellation of her program, 'The ReidOut.' Daniels, who has been a contributor since 2021, is known for his expertise on Kamala Harris and pop culture references, including being a 'walking Beyoncé encyclopedia.' The lineup changes come amidst a broader restructuring under new MSNBC President Rebecca Kutler, which also sees other hosts transitioning to new time slots. Joy Reid, in an emotional podcast interview, expressed her feelings of anger, guilt, and gratitude over her show's cancellation, emphasizing her commitment to progressive issues. Despite Reid's exit, MSNBC appears to maintain its progressive stance, with Daniels' hiring marking a new chapter for the network. The revamped 'The Weekend' show is set to launch in late April and will feature additional co-hosts yet to be announced.
